Product Description

Editorial Review

For daredevil children and rescue lovers, this easy-to-assemble playset offers excitement at every turn. As soon as a would-be robber crashes into the side of the bank, breaking it open, kids can get on the horn and call for help. A microphone in the radio allows children to broadcast their voices. And the chase is on! The die-cast police SUV speeds down the incline from the tower above the bank, while the ambulance hurries to the scene from the main road. Two more buttons on top of the radio sound out the bank's alarm and the siren of the police car. Should the robbers attempt to get away, never fear. They'll soon drive over the door of the jailhouse, which then flips up to trap them behind bars. --Pam Lauer

4.0 out of 5 stars Fun but pricey, June 14, 2002
By A Customer
= Durability:2.0 out of 5 stars  = Fun:4.0 out of 5 stars  = Educational:4.0 out of 5 stars 
This review is from: Matchbox Radio Centre Playset (Toy)
It is a fun toy. I bought it for my three year old boy. However, the track seperates a lot at the down curve and the radio does not project as well as I would have expected even with brand new batteries. I think the box makes the crashes look far more exciting than it is...in fact getting the cars to crash can be difficult since you can't line the cars up through the top as it only fits one car at a time. I think if it was priced [lower] it would have been more appropriate.

2.0 out of 5 stars Not Durable at all!!, December 17, 2002
By 
= Durability:1.0 out of 5 stars  = Fun:2.0 out of 5 stars  = Educational:1.0 out of 5 stars 
This review is from: Matchbox Radio Centre Playset (Toy)
I bought this for my nephew last christmas. It went together easy enough, but it came apart after every car went down the track. He got a kick out of the speaker device(that lasted a week before it broke). He also got a kick out of having the cars land in the cel at the end of the ramp. I gues it would be fun if it actually stayed together longer than thirty seconds.
